Minutes — Management Meeting, Corvane Logistics

Present: Finance team, D. Aldwin (CFO).

The quarterly cash-flow forecast was reviewed. Receivables collection improved to 42 days; Q3 inflows are projected 6% above plan. Fuel cost hedging offsets most margin pressure. Capex on the Delmere depot shifts to Q4. Aldwin asked for a revised sensitivity table by month-end. The allocation of the projected surplus is addressed in the confidential note below.

confidential, fafog-fafog: Only 21 of the 82 pilot accounts renewed Holwyn, so a churn review is set for September 1. Normirox Logistics is in early talks to buy Praiusox Foods for about $134.2 million.

Subject: Cut-over summary — Pipewren log compaction

Team,

The Pipewren broker cut-over finished Tuesday at 03:10 with no message loss. We moved from time-based retention to keyed log compaction on the settlements topic, which cut disk usage on the Drayton cluster by roughly 60%. Consumer lag spiked briefly during segment rewrites but recovered within eight minutes. For the record, the brokers now run with these settings.

service settings:
[casax]
port = 6379
team = rusir
host = casax.zemvarhq.corp
region = outer-4
access_code = ac_9808ce
timeout_ms = 1500

## Master Key Set Transfer — Holloway Annex

The full master key set for the Holloway Annex is transported only by vetted courier, never by internal post. Keys travel in a sealed, numbered pouch logged out by the records team and logged in at destination within the hour. Any seal discrepancy must be reported immediately. The courier hand-over instruction appears directly below.

handover note for yagef-bagep: the drudor pelius courier leaves the kasdor zorvan norir ledger at gate 8016 under passcode 755406